Turner moves forward with $399m Seattle-Tacoma Airport expansion contract

Turner Construction is moving forward with a $399 million project to expand C Concourse at Seattle-Tacoma International Airport, after the Port of Seattle Commission approved the budget earlier this month.

The expansion will increase the size of C Concourse from 80,000 square feet (7,432 sq m) to over 226,000 square feet (21,000 sq m).

Construction will begin in early 2024 and is expected to be completed in 2027.

The project will add dining and retail options as well as offer amenities such as an interfaith prayer and meditation room and a nursing suite.

The concourse will also be home to a 20,000 square foot (1858 sq m) Alaska Airlines lounge.

It will employ fossil-fuel-free systems for heating, tenant hot water, and cooking. Sustainable and efficient features will conserve energy and water use including a rooftop solar array, electrochromic glazing on windows, and water efficient fixtures.

“We understand the importance of this project and the difference we can make by implementing sustainable building strategies into the expansion of this terminal,” said Bill Ketcham, vice president and general manager, Turner Construction Company.
